About Black & Veatch

Black & Veatch is a global engineering and construction company. The company was founded in 1915 and is headquartered in Overland Park, Kansas. Black & Veatch provides a range of services, including eng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) services, consulting, and environmental services. The company serves a variety of industries, including power, water, telecommunications, and oil and gas. Black & Veatch has operations in more than 100 countries around the world.
